In 2009, Bath & Body Works implemented Oracle E-Business Suite as its ERP Financial platform supporting corporate accounting and finance functions. The implementation centralized the monthly close process, weekly projection submissions, and participation in the financial projection process for home office departments, while also supporting twice yearly company budget preparation and list rentals revenue and customer loyalty program accounting. Configuration and functional work focused on G/L maintenance and systems driven accounting activities within Oracle E-Business Suite, embedding general ledger controls and automated accounting workflows. The project included the implementation and ongoing maintenance of Blackline account reconciliation software integrated into the close process to manage reconciliations and to support month end orchestration. The deployment covered home office finance and accounting operations and was used to support accounting for strategic transactions, including the Dress Barn purchase of Tween Brands. In 2012 the company completed an Oracle R12 upgrade and a company wide conversion to Oracle, and implementation teams created company and account hierarchy structures in Oracle to enable expansion into Canada and to add the Brothers clothing line within the system. Governance and process changes emphasized using Oracle E-Business Suite to drive process improvements across all financial departments, standardize projection and budget workflows, and institutionalize G/L maintenance as part of periodic close and budgeting cycles. Operational ownership remained with finance and accounting, with centralized reconciliation and close governance supported by the combined Oracle and Blackline application set.

In 2020, Bath & Body Works implemented Oracle Cloud HCM Benefits to centralize employee benefits administration for its United States workforce of 8,800 employees. The deployment addressed the companys Benefits Administration requirements, focusing on enrollment, eligibility rules, plan configuration, and carrier file management to standardize benefits processing across HR operations. Oracle Cloud HCM Benefits configuration covered benefit plan setup, open enrollment workflows, event driven life event processing, eligibility logic, census management, and benefits reporting and analytics. The implementation used built in capabilities for benefit elections management, billing reconciliation, and regular benefits data validation consistent with the Benefits Administration category. Operational design aligned benefits master data with core HR records to maintain eligibility accuracy and to support HR and finance interactions, including payroll handoffs and carrier communications. The scope of administration included the corporate HR benefits team and cross functional coordination with payroll, finance, and external carriers within the United States. In 2019, Bath & Body Works implemented Ironclad CLM to centralize contract activities within the Legal Department. Ironclad CLM, a Contract Lifecycle Management solution, was positioned to support the Legal Operations Manager and the broader legal and compliance organization for domestic and international business initiatives. The deployment focused on core Contract Lifecycle Management capabilities including contract authoring and templating, structured approval workflows, a searchable clause library, centralized contract repository, and reporting on contract status and obligations. Configuration work emphasized aligning templates and approval matrices with business unit and compliance requirements, and automating routing and notification workflows to reduce manual handoffs.
